### Catalogue import stalls at 90%

If the Wrenfield catalogue import hangs near the end, it's almost always the MARC-ish records with missing shelf codes — the importer retries them forever instead of skipping. Quick fix: enable `skip_unshelved` and re-run. To pull the failed-record report from the import service, hit the diagnostics endpoint using the bearer token below.

session JWT of yawep-yawep = eyJhbGciOiJIUzI1NiIsInR5cCI6IkpXVCJ9.eyJzdWIiOiI3pWF3_In0.aXYsHiog

Action item from the Mirewater tide-table widget incident. Owner: release manager. Widget cached stale harbor offsets after the DST change, showing tides six hours off for two days. Required: add a cache-invalidation check to the release checklist, block deploys when offset tables are older than 24 hours, and verify the Saltgate harbor feed before each cut. Deadline: next release. Checklist template and sign-off procedure are documented on the internal page below.

wiki page, kawif-bajep: https://artifactory.zarqelforge.internal/issue/browse/display/display/projects/spaces/secrets/000fe6ec5a46af29355003e1

### Dedup pass: customer records

Quick one for review. The Marloweave dedup job merges customer records nightly by fuzzy-matching name and postal fields, then flags collisions for manual review rather than auto-merging. Nothing leaves the batch subnet, and merge decisions are audit-logged with the operator's role. If you're checking the blast radius, the matcher thresholds and retention window matter most. The job runs with the following configuration.

service settings:
[casax]
port = 6379
team = rusir
host = casax.zemvarhq.corp
region = outer-4
access_code = ac_9808ce
timeout_ms = 1500